## Step 4: Migrate EXIF scrubber state

The old Pellgrove scrubber kept its processed-file ledger in flat files. Version 3 moves this to a relational table, `scrub_ledger`, with checksum and timestamp columns. Run `scrubctl migrate --from legacy` once; it is idempotent. Failures leave a resume marker, so re-running is safe. Verify row counts against the legacy manifest before deleting flat files. The migration tool reads its target database from the following:

primary connection of yaguf-tagug = mongodb://sorox_svc:RmJoU4HZbLmruH@db-0593.qorvelworks.internal:5432/fraius

Management Meeting Minutes — Pellwright Holdings

Attendees: dept heads, counsel. Topic: licensing dispute with Ordanel Labs over the Fletchline toolkit. Counsel advised settlement over litigation; cost estimates circulated. Marketing to pause Fletchline promotion pending resolution. Decision deferred to next session. Heads should review the confidential note on business plans appended below before then.

board note of baguf-fafog: Kasixox Foods plans to lower the Drueth list price by 48 percent in March.

## Handover: Alert Deduplicator (Quillmere)

Handing off the deduplicator service to Taro. Dedup windows are 90 seconds; collision keys are hashed per source. For the security review, note that the recovery account is dormant by default and only wakes via the break-glass flow, which prompts for the passphrase given below.

unlock words, fafop-hawep: briwyn-oliix-sorox